Features and Applications
Nickel-chromium-molybdenum alloy designed for joining C22, 625, 825 or combinations of these alloys.
Provides a tough Nb-free weld metal for dissimilar welds in super austenitic and super duplex stainless steels.
Offers excellent resistance against stress & corrosion cracking, pitting and crevice corrosion.
Extensively used for overlays and cladding of lower alloy steels.
Typically used in the welding of aggressively corrosive media in chemical processing plants, corrosion resistant overlays and in severe offshore and petrochemical environments
Typical Base Materials
Alloy 22, Alloy 625, Alloy 825, Alloy 926
Standards |
EN ISO 18274 – Ni 6022 – NiCr21Mo13Fe4W3 |
AWS A5.14 – ER NiCrMo-10 |

Shielding Gases
EN ISO 14175 – TIG: I1 (Argon)
Welding Positions
EN ISO 6947 – PA, PB, PC, PD, PE, PF, PG
